DTC P0137: 1/2 O2 Sensor Shorted To Ground: Testing

NOTE: 1/2 HO2S may also be referred to as an downstream oxygen sensor. 1/2 HO2S is located behind right catalytic converter.
  1. Turn ignition on. Using scan tool, read DTCs. If GLOBAL GOOD TRIP counter is displayed and displayed count is "0", go to next step. If GLOBAL GOOD TRIP counter is not displayed or displayed count is not "0", go to step  6.
  2. Turn ignition on. Using scan tool, read 1/2 HO2S signal voltage. Disconnect 1/2 HO2S connector and note voltage reading. If voltage is more than .16 volt, replace 1/2 HO2S. If voltage is .16 volt or less, go to next step.
  3. Turn ignition off. Disconnect PCM connectors. PCM is located on left side of engine compartment, between Power Distribution Center (PDC) and Transmission Control Module (TCM). See Figure. Visually inspect connectors for corroded, damaged, pushed-out or miswired terminals. Repair connectors as necessary. If connectors are okay, measure resistance between ground and Tan/White wire at 1/2 HO2S harness connector. If resistance is 5 ohms or more, go to next step. If resistance is less than 5 ohms, repair short to ground in Tan/White wire between 1/2 HO2S and PCM.
  4. Measure resistance between Tan/White wire and Black/Light Blue wire at 1/2 HO2S harness connector. If resistance is 5 ohms or more, go to next step. If resistance is less than 5 ohms, Tan/White wire is shorted to Black/Light Blue wire. Repair wiring as necessary.
  5. At this time, PCM is assumed to be defective. Replace PCM.
  6. Turn ignition off. Visually inspect related connectors and wiring harness for damage. Repair connectors and wiring harness as necessary. If connectors and wiring harness are okay, reconnect all connectors. Start engine. Wiggle 1/2 HO2S connector and wiring harness while monitoring scan tool display. If GOOD TRIP counter display count changes to "0", repair connector or wiring harness where wiggling caused display to change. If GOOD TRIP counter display count does not change to "0", no problem is indicated at this time. Check for any related technical service bulletins that may apply.
